6 Setup Setting the date and time, changing the display language Setting the date and time Before recording, check that the date and time have been set. The very first time that power is turned ON, a message appears prompting you to set the date and time. Select [YES], press the center of the cursor buttons and proceed to step 3 . 1 Set to [ ] or [ ]. 2 Select the desired menu. →[BASIC]→ [CLOCK SET]→[YES] 3 Set the date and time. To change the date and time display ●To change an item →[SETUP]→ [DATE/TIME] [OFF] : Date and time are not displayed. [D/T] : Date and time are displayed. [DATE] : Only the date is displayed. ●To change the date format →[SETUP]→ [DATE FORMAT] Format indication [Y/M/D] [M/D/Y] [D/M/Y] Appearance on LCD monitor 2007.DEC.15 DEC.15.2007 15.DEC.2007 30 VQT1M21 To select settings To change numerical values The year is displayed up to 2099 and the 12-hour system is used to display the time. 4 Enter the date and time. • The clock function starts at [00] seconds. • After pressing the [MENU] button and closing the menu, check the date and time displays.
